How Does RemoteIoT Integrate with AWS VPC?
RemoteIoT integrates with AWS VPC by creating a secure tunnel between your Raspberry Pi devices and the AWS infrastructure. This tunnel ensures that all data transmitted between your devices and the cloud is encrypted, protecting it from unauthorized access. By using AWS VPC, you can define custom network configurations, such as IP address ranges and subnets, to isolate your IoT devices from other parts of your network. This isolation enhances security and allows you to control access to your devices more effectively.

How to Secure Your RemoteIoT VPC Network Raspberry Pi AWS Setup?
Securing your RemoteIoT VPC Network Raspberry Pi AWS setup involves implementing best practices for network security and device management. First, ensure that your AWS VPC is properly configured with appropriate security groups and network access control lists (NACLs). Next, regularly update your Raspberry Pi's software to patch any vulnerabilities and ensure compatibility with RemoteIoT's tools.
Best Practices for Securing Your IoT Devices
1. Use strong passwords and enable multi-factor authentication for your AWS account.
2. Regularly update your Raspberry Pi's operating system and applications.
3. Monitor your network for suspicious activity using AWS's monitoring tools.
Tools and Techniques for Enhancing Security
- Implement encryption for data in transit and at rest
- Use AWS's Identity and Access Management (IAM) to control access to your resources
- Enable logging and monitoring to detect and respond to security incidents

Custom Routing Tables and Subnets
Custom routing tables and subnets allow you to control the flow of traffic within your VPC. By defining specific routes and subnets, you can isolate your IoT devices from other parts of your network and ensure that data is transmitted securely and efficiently.
